Why 75 Ball Bingo and Free Spins Go Together
First, a quick thought. 75 ball bingo is the American style. It uses a 5×5 grid, and you are playing for specific patterns like an X, a T, or a full house. It is faster than 90 ball, which I find a bit slow sometimes. The patterns make it more interesting, you know? You aren’t just waiting for the last number.

Can I win real cash from free spins?
Yes. That is the point. But “real cash” comes with conditions. You have to wager the winnings. For example, you win £5 from free spins. With a 35x wagering requirement, you need to place £175 in bets before you can withdraw. That is doable, but you need to know it upfront.

A Small Complaint About Free Spins
I have to be honest. Not all free spins are created equal. Some sites give you 50 spins, but each spin is only 1p. That is worthless. I prefer fewer spins with a higher value. A site giving 20 spins at 25p each is better than 100 spins at 1p. It is just math.
Also, some sites attach the free spins to a bingo purchase. That feels fair. You buy your tickets, you get your spins. Other sites make you deposit a specific amount, say £20, and then you get the spins. That is okay, but it feels less like a gift and more like a condition.
I’ll give a reluctant compliment to one site. Their email support actually answered my question about wagering contributions. Slots contribute 100% to wagering. But bingo tickets? Only 50% on some sites. That is sneaky. If you are trying to wager your free spin winnings, you want to play slots, not bingo, because the slots count more. That was a helpful piece of info.
